Data specific to Irises (Edit)
Hybridizer: Barry Blyth
Year Of Registration: 1997
Year Of Introduction (May Differ From Registry): 1997
Seedling Number: D41-1
Classification: Tall Bearded (TB)
Registered Height: 36 inches (92 cm)
Bloom Season: Mid
Flower Form: Ruffled
Bloom Color Classification: Rose
White
Flower Patterns: Plicata
Bloom Color Description: White standards, rosy pink allover flush; cream white falls lightening toward center, 1/4" rosy pink plicata edge deeper at hafts
Beard Color: Burnt tangerine
Fragrance: Slight

General Plant Information (Edit)
Life cycle: Perennial
Sun Requirements: Full Sun to Partial Shade
Soil pH Preferences: Slightly acid (6.1 – 6.5)
Neutral (6.6 – 7.3)
Slightly alkaline (7.4 – 7.8)
Minimum cold hardiness: Zone 3 -40 °C (-40 °F) to -37.2 °C (-35)
Maximum recommended zone: Zone 9b
Flowers: Showy
Fragrant
Underground structures: Rhizome
Propagation: Seeds: Will not come true from seed
Propagation: Other methods: Division
Ploidy: Tetraploid
Parentage: Lemon Silence X K. Turner KH91-3-1: (Bama Berry x Holiday Lover)
